Information about the ferry connection Civitavecchia - Tunis
| Ferry connection: | Civitavecchia ⇄ Tunis |
| Ports of the ferry connection: |
|
| Number of crossings: | up to 2 times a week |
| Travel time / journey time: | 17 hours 30 minutes bis 27 hours |
| Distance: | 614 Kilometers (ca. 331,5 Nautical miles) |
| Season: | All year round (January to December) |
| Check-in: | 210 to 240 minutes before departure |
| Operator of the ferry connection: |
Grandi Navi Veloci (GNV) Grimaldi Lines |

Travel information
Arrival by car
You can reach the ferry port of Civitavecchia by taking the A12/E80 highway. This highway connects Rome with Civitavecchia. If you are coming from the north, take the A12/E80 highway and drive south to the port. From Rome, ferry north on the A12/E80 directly to the port. In Civitavecchia, take the E840 or the SS1 and follow the signs to the ferry port.
Arrival by bus and train
Civitavecchia station is well connected to the regional and national train network. Trains from Rome and other Italian cities stop regularly in Civitavecchia. From the train station, you can walk to the ferry port or take a local bus. There are also bus services that connect Rome and other cities directly to the ferry port.
Arrival by plane
The nearest major airport is Rome-Fiumicino Airport. From there you can take a train to Rome and then on to Civitavecchia. Alternatively, there are also direct bus connections from Fiumicino Airport to the ferry port of Civitavecchia.

What is the latest time I have to check in at Ferry Civitavecchia-Tunis?
You must check in at the port at least 210 to 240 minutes before departure. However, allow a little more time.
- GNV check-in: up to 240 minutes before departure
- Grimaldi Lines check-in: up to 210 minutes before departure
What happens if I don't arrive at the port on time?
That can happen, of course. However, the Ferry will not wait for you, as the timetable must be adhered to.
As soon as you realize that you will not make it to check-in at the port on time, you should contact the shipping company by telephone. You will find the telephone number on your booking confirmation.
How often does the Ferry ferry travel from Civitavecchia to Tunis in Tunisia?
The Civitavecchia-Tunis ferry connection is currently offered up to twice a week.
How long does the Ferry ferry take from Civitavecchia to Tunis?
The journey time (duration of the crossing) is between 17 hours and 32 hours, depending on the direction of travel.
The longer crossing involves a stopover in Sicily.
Can I take my dog with me on the Ferry?
Yes, that’s not a problem. Dogs and small pets such as cats travel as normal with Ferry.
GNVPlease note that a muzzle and a leash are mandatory for dogs .
Grimaldi Lines: Pets are generally allowed on the outside decks of Ferry. They must wear a muzzle and be kept on a lead. If you would like to take your pet with you in the cabin, you can purchase a pet kit from the on-board services during the booking process.
